>The default supplicant behavior in Windows XP is PEAP using the logged-in 
>user's credentials.

So? That is so *if* NAS asks for credentials. If you are using mac
authentication and don't want to authenticate users - don't set your
NAS to use 802.1x. You can allocate VLANs from radius on basis of mac
alone (which is what you want to do).

>Can FreeRADIUS authenticate everyone in an 802.1x/PEAP environment without 
>regard to the credentials they provide?

The whole point of EAP is to prevent this. No RFC compliant radius server
will do that.
